It's never a dull moment in the ongoing saga between Jonathan Kuminga and the Golden State Warriors . The Warriors' fifth-year forward received his first DNP-CD (Did Not Play — Coach's Decision) of the season in the Dubs' 123-91 win over the Chicago Bulls, just 24 hours after starting in the win against the Cleveland Cavaliers.

With no Stephen Curry, Draymond Green, or Al Horford, Steve Kerr opted to go with other options along the bench, riding the hot hand with guys like Pat Spencer, Gui Santos, De'Anthony Melton, and Gary Payton II.
